Как сделать сортировку по алфавиту в Excel: 5 проверенных способов

Работа с данными в Microsoft Excel часто требует упорядочивания информации — особенно когда речь идет о текстовых столбцах с фамилиями, названиями или категориями. Сортировка по алфавиту — одна из самых востребованных операций, которая экономит часы ручной работы. Но даже опытные пользователи иногда сталкиваются с неожиданными проблемами: почему-то пропали данные после сортировки, или Excel упорно игнорирует регистр букв, а иногда и вовсе сортирует "по-своему".

В этой статье вы найдете 5 рабочих способов отсортировать таблицу по алфавиту — от базовых до продвинутых. Мы разберем не только стандартные инструменты ленты, но и горячие клавиши, сортировку с учетом регистра, а также обработку данных с объединенными ячейками или скрытыми строками. Особое внимание уделим типичным ошибкам, из-за которых Excel "ломает" таблицу после сортировки — и как их избежать.

Если вам нужно быстро привести в порядок список клиентов, каталог товаров или любой другой текстовый массив — эта инструкция сэкономит вам время. А для тех, кто работает с большими базами данных, мы подготовили бонусный раздел о сортировке с помощью Power Query — инструмента, который справится даже с миллионом строк за секунды.

📊 Как часто вы сортируете данные в Excel?
Ежедневно
Несколько раз в неделю
Редко
Никогда не пользовался сортировкой

1. Базовая сортировка по алфавиту: инструмент на ленте

Самый простой способ отсортировать данные — использовать кнопки на главной панели Excel. Этот метод подходит для однократной сортировки одного столбца или всей таблицы. Вот как это работает:

Выделите диапазон ячеек, который нужно отсортировать (включая заголовки столбцов). Если выделение не включает заголовки, Excel спросит, нужно ли их добавить. Затем перейдите на вкладку Главная → группа Редактирование → кнопки Сортировка и фильтр (значок воронки). Здесь доступны два варианта:

  • 🔤 Сортировка от А до Я — по возрастанию (алфавитный порядок)
  • 🔠 Сортировка от Я до А — по убыванию (обратный алфавитный порядок)

Если выделить один столбец, Excel отсортирует только его, оставив остальные данные на месте. Чтобы отсортировать всю таблицу по выбранному столбцу, выделите весь диапазон (включая соседние столбцы). Например, если у вас таблица с фамилиями в столбце A и телефонами в B, выделите оба столбца перед сортировкой — так номера телефонов "поедут" вместе с фамилиями.

⚠️ Внимание: Если в выделенном диапазоне есть пустые строки или столбцы, Excel может разорвать связь между данными. Например, фамилии из строки 5 окажутся рядом с телефонами из строки 7. Всегда проверяйте границы выделения перед сортировкой!

Этот метод работает в Excel 2007–2026 и Excel Online. В Mac-версии путь к кнопкам сортировки аналогичный, но внешний вид иконок может немного отличаться.

2. Расширенная сортировка: несколько уровней и критериев

Когда нужно отсортировать данные по нескольким столбцам одновременно (например, сначала по фамилиям, а затем по именам), стандартные кнопки на ленте не подойдут. Здесь поможет инструмент Настраиваемая сортировка. Он позволяет:

  • 📌 Устанавливать приоритет столбцов (сначала по одному критерию, затем по другому)
  • 🔄 Выбирать порядок сортировки для каждого столбца отдельно
  • 🖥️ Сортировать по цвету ячейки, цвету шрифта или значкам

Чтобы открыть настраиваемую сортировку:

  1. Выделите диапазон данных (включая заголовки).
  2. Перейдите на вкладку Данные → группа Сортировка и фильтр → кнопка Сортировка.
  3. В открывшемся окне выберите первый столбец для сортировки из выпадающего списка Сортировать по.
  4. Добавьте дополнительные уровни сортировки кнопкой Добавить уровень.

Пример: у вас есть таблица с данными о сотрудниках — Фамилия (столбец A), Имя (столбец B), Отдел (столбец C). Чтобы отсортировать сначала по отделам, а внутри каждого отдела — по фамилиям, настройте два уровня:

  1. Уровень 1: Сортировать поОтдел (столбец C), порядок А–Я.
  2. Уровень 2: Затем поФамилия (столбец A), порядок А–Я.
ФамилияИмяОтдел
АлексеевИванБухгалтерия
БорисовПетрЛогистика
ВаснецовАлексейБухгалтерия
ГригорьевСергейЛогистика
ДмитриеваОльгаМаркетинг

Пример таблицы до сортировки

После применения настраиваемой сортировки таблица примет вид:

ФамилияИмяОтдел
АлексеевИванБухгалтерия
ВаснецовАлексейБухгалтерия
БорисовПетрЛогистика
ГригорьевСергейЛогистика
ДмитриеваОльгаМаркетинг

Та же таблица после сортировки по отделам, а затем по фамилиям

3. Горячие клавиши для быстрой сортировки

Если вы часто работаете с сортировкой, сочетания клавиш сэкономят вам массу времени. Вот основные комбинации для Windows и Mac:

  • 🪟 Windows:
    • Alt + H → S → S — сортировка от А до Я
    • Alt + H → S → O — сортировка от Я до А
    • Alt + D → S — открыть окно настраиваемой сортировки
  • 🍎 Mac:
    • Command + Option + H → S → S
    • Command + Option + D → S для настраиваемой сортировки

Чтобы запомнить эти комбинации, представьте, что: H = Home (главная вкладка), D = Data (данные), S = Sort (сортировка).

При использовании горячих клавиш обязательно выделяйте диапазон данных перед нажатием. Если ячейки не выделены, Excel отсортирует только активный столбец, что может привести к разрыву связи между данными в строках.

⚠️ Внимание: В Excel Online горячие клавиши могут не работать или отличаться. Для веб-версии лучше использовать кнопки на ленте.

Убедиться, что выделен весь диапазон данных (включая заголовки)|Проверить отсутствие пустых строк/столбцов внутри диапазона|Разъединить объединенные ячейки (если есть)|Сохранить резервную копию файла (для больших таблиц)-->

4. Сортировка с учетом регистра и специальные случаи

По умолчанию Excel игнорирует регистр букв при сортировке: слова "Аппельсин" и "аппельсин" будут считаться одинаковыми. Но иногда требуется чувствительность к регистру — например, при работе с каталожными номерами или паролями. Для этого:

  1. Откройте окно настраиваемой сортировки (Данные → Сортировка).
  2. Нажмите кнопку Параметры в правом верхнем углу.
  3. Включите опцию Учитывать регистр.

Теперь строки с заглавными буквами будут идти после строчных. Например:

  • абракадабра
  • Абракадабра
  • Барабан

Другие неочевидные случаи, с которыми сталкиваются пользователи:

  • 🔢 Числа в текстовых ячейках: Excel сортирует их как текст ("100" пойдет перед "20"). Чтобы исправить, преобразуйте данные в числовой формат (Главная → Формат → Формат ячеек → Числовой).
  • 📅 Даты в текстовом виде: "01.01.2026" и "1 января 2026" будут отсортированы как текст, а не по хронологии. Используйте формат Дата.
  • 🌍 Кириллица и латиница: Русские буквы идут после латинских (A–Z → А–Я). Чтобы изменить порядок, используйте пользовательскую сортировку (см. раздел 6).

Если в вашей таблице есть скрытые строки или столбцы, Excel по умолчанию сортирует только видимые данные. Чтобы включить скрытые элементы:

  1. В окне настраиваемой сортировки нажмите Параметры.
  2. Снимите галочку с Сортировать только в пределах видимого диапазона.
Почему Excel сортирует "10" перед "2"

При текстовой сортировке Excel сравнивает символы слева направо. Цифра "1" в "10" идет раньше "2" в "2", поэтому "10" оказывается выше. Чтобы исправить, преобразуйте данные в числовой формат или добавьте ведущие нули ("02" вместо "2").

5. Продвинутая сортировка: Power Query для больших данных

Если вы работаете с таблицами на десятки тысяч строк, стандартная сортировка Excel может тормозить или даже зависать. В таких случаях на помощь приходит Power Query — инструмент для обработки больших данных, встроенный в Excel 2016 и новее (также доступен как надстройка для Excel 2010–2013).

Преимущества сортировки через Power Query:

  • ⚡ Обрабатывает миллионы строк за секунды
  • 🔄 Сохраняет историю преобразований (можно откатиться)
  • 🔗 Не изменяет исходные данные (работает с копией)

Пошаговая инструкция:

  1. Выделите вашу таблицу и перейдите на вкладку ДанныеИз таблицы/диапазона (в группе Получить и преобразовать данные).
  2. В открывшемся редакторе Power Query выделите столбец, по которому нужно отсортировать данные.
  3. На вкладке Главная (в редакторе) выберите:
    • Сортировка по возрастанию (А–Я)
    • или Сортировка по убыванию (Я–А)
  • Нажмите Закрыть и загрузить, чтобы применить изменения.
  • Результат будет загружен на новый лист Excel, а исходные данные останутся нетронутыми. Если позже понадобится обновить сортировку (например, после добавления новых строк), просто кликните правой кнопкой по результату и выберите Обновить.

    ⚠️ Внимание: В Power Query сортировка не сохраняется как часть формулы, если выlater добавите новые данные. Чтобы сортировка применялась автоматически, используйте Таблицы Excel (см. раздел 7).

    6. Пользовательские списки сортировки

    Иногда алфавитный порядок не подходит. Например, вам нужно отсортировать дни недели так: Понедельник → Вторник → ... → Воскресенье, а не по алфавиту (Вторник → Понедельник → Среда...). Для таких случаев в Excel есть пользовательские списки сортировки.

    Создать свой список можно так:

    1. Перейдите в Файл → Параметры → Дополнительно.
    2. Прокрутите вниз до раздела Общие и нажмите Изменить списки.
    3. В окне Списки выберите НОВЫЙ СПИСОК и введите элементы в нужном порядке (каждый с новой строки).
    4. Нажмите Добавить, затем ОК.
    5. Теперь при настраиваемой сортировке (Данные → Сортировка) в списке Порядок появится ваш пользовательский вариант. Это полезно для:

      • 📅 Дней недели/месяцев (чтобы сортировались по хронологии)
      • 🏷️ Категорий товаров (например, "Премиум → Стандарт → Эконом")
      • 👥 Должностей (директор → менеджер → стажер)

    Если вам нужно однократно отсортировать данные по нестандартному порядку, можно обойтись без создания списка. Просто добавьте вспомогательный столбец с цифрами, соответствующими нужному порядку, и отсортируйте по нему.

    7. Автоматическая сортировка с помощью таблиц Excel

    Если ваша таблица часто обновляется, и вам нужно, чтобы данные автоматически сортировались при добавлении новых строк, преобразуйте диапазон в Таблицу Excel. Для этого:

    1. Выделите диапазон (включая заголовки).
    2. Нажмите Ctrl + T или выберите Главная → Форматировать как таблицу.
    3. В открывшемся окне подтвердите, что в первой строке находятся заголовки.

    Теперь при добавлении новых данных в конец таблицы вы можете одним кликом обновить сортировку:

    • Щелкните по стрелочке фильтра в заголовке столбца.
    • Выберите Сортировка от А до Я или Сортировка от Я до А.

    Преимущества таблиц Excel:

    • 🔄 Автоматическое расширение при добавлении строк
    • 🎨 Стилизация (чередование цветов строк, выделение заголовков)
    • 📊 Автоматические итоги (можно добавить строку с суммой/средним)

    Чтобы отменить сортировку и вернуть исходный порядок, используйте функцию Отменить (Ctrl + Z) или удалите фильтры через Данные → Сортировка и фильтр → Очистить.

    8. Типичные ошибки и как их избежать

    Даже опытные пользователи Excel иногда сталкиваются с проблемами при сортировке. Вот TOP-5 ошибок и их решения:

    1. Данные "разъехались" по строкам

    🔹 Причина: Выделили только один столбец вместо всей таблицы.

    🔹 Решение: Отмените действие (Ctrl + Z) и выделите весь диапазон перед сортировкой. Или используйте Таблицы Excel (раздел 7).

    2. Сортировка игнорирует пустые ячейки

    🔹 Причина: По умолчанию пустые ячейки помещаются в конец списка.

    🔹 Решение: В настройках сортировки (Параметры) выберите Сверху или Снизу для пустых значений.

    3. Числа сортируются как текст

    🔹 Причина: Ячейки отформатированы как текст, а не как числа.

    🔹 Решение: Выделите проблемный столбец → Главная → Формат → Формат ячеек → Числовой. Или используйте функцию =ЗНАЧЕН() для преобразования.

    4. Русские и английские буквы перемешались

    🔹 Причина: Excel сортирует латиницу перед кириллицей (A–Z → А–Я).

    🔹 Решение: Добавьте вспомогательный столбец с формулой =КОДСИМВ(ЛЕВСИМВ(A1)), чтобы разделить алфавиты по кодам символов.

    5. Сортировка "зависает" на больших таблицах

    🔹 Причина: Ограничения стандартной сортировки Excel (максимум ~1 млн строк).

    🔹 Решение: Используйте Power Query (раздел 5) или разбейте данные на несколько листов.

    Если ни один из способов не помог, проверьте таблицу на наличие:

    • 🔗 Связанных данных (формулы, зависящие от других листов)
    • 🔒 Защищенных ячеек (сортировка не работает на заблокированных диапазонах)
    • 📎 Объединенных ячеек (разъедините их перед сортировкой)

    FAQ: Частые вопросы о сортировке в Excel

    Можно ли отсортировать данные по цвету ячейки?

    Да, для этого используйте настраиваемую сортировку (Данные → Сортировка). В списке столбцов выберите нужный, а в поле Сортировка по укажите Цвет ячейки или Цвет шрифта. Затем выберите цвет из палитры.

    Это полезно, например, для сортировки данных по категориям, выделенным условным форматированием.

    Как отсортировать таблицу по алфавиту, но оставить заголовки на месте?

    Excel автоматически распознает заголовки, если они выделены жирным или отличаются по формату. Если заголовки "уехали" вместе с данными:

    1. Отмените сортировку (Ctrl + Z).
    2. Выделите диапазон без заголовков (со второй строки).
    3. Примените сортировку.

    Или закрепите заголовки: Вид → Закрепить области → Закрепить верхнюю строку.

    Почему после сортировки пропали некоторые строки?

    Это происходит, если:

    • В таблице были скрытые строки, а в параметрах сортировки стояла галочка Сортировать только в пределах видимого диапазона.
    • Данные были отфильтрованы до сортировки (сначала снимите фильтр: Данные → Сортировка и фильтр → Очистить).
    • В таблице есть пустые строки, которые Excel воспринял как разрыв диапазона.

    Чтобы вернуть данные, отмените сортировку или восстановите файл из резервной копии.

    Как отсортировать данные по алфавиту в Google Таблицах?

    В Google Sheets процесс аналогичен Excel:

    1. Выделите диапазон.
    2. Нажмите Данные → Сортировать диапазон.
    3. Выберите столбец и порядок сортировки.

    Для сложной сортировки используйте Данные → Сортировать диапазон → Дополнительные параметры сортировки.

    Горячие клавиши в Google Таблицах:

    • Alt + Shift + S — открыть меню сортировки
    • Alt + D → S → A — сортировка по возрастанию

    Можно ли отсортировать данные по алфавиту в Excel на телефоне?

    Да, в мобильной версии Excel (Android/iOS) сортировка доступна, но с ограничениями:

    1. Откройте файл в приложении Excel.
    2. Коснитесь заголовка столбца → выберите значок фильтра (воронка).
    3. Нажмите Сортировка и выберите порядок.

    Обратите внимание:

    • Настраиваемая сортировка (несколько уровней) доступна только в полной версии Excel.
    • Горячие клавиши на телефоне не работают.
    • Для больших таблиц (>10 000 строк) может потребоваться десктопная версия.